Michael Vaughan yesterday revealed he has been stricken with a stress-induced inflammatory sickness for the previous 9 months that leaves him incapable of buttoning his shirt or tying his shoelaces.
The previous England captain instructed the Each day Telegraph his signs have been so extreme final Boxing Day that in Australia’s Take a look at match towards Pakistan, unable to raise the microphone, he was despatched from the commentary field to a Melbourne hospital.
‘If I had been 80 with this, I might have needed to be shot,’ Vaughan, 49, mentioned, detailing the insufferable ranges of ache in his joints accompanying immobility.

‘Individuals at all times discuss psychological sickness being the toughest to detect, as a result of it is not a visual harm, it’s simply one thing that occurs inside your thoughts. It is just like this sickness. Over time, it simply builds up.’
After returning to the UK, he was despatched for a CT scan that confirmed irritation in his physique was being triggered by stress hormones.
Time-stamping the build-up was simple. For 3 years, Vaughan vehemently denied a single comment his ex-team mate Azeem Rafiq claimed he’d made to a gaggle of Yorkshire gamers of Asian heritage throughout a county match at Trent Bridge: ‘There’s too lots of you lot, we have to do one thing about that.’
Final April, a Cricket Self-discipline Fee concluded that, on the steadiness of chances, he had not mentioned these phrases on the time and within the particular circumstances alleged.

Vaughan, whose bodily well-being has improved via steroid remedy, instructed the Telegraph: ‘I do not know if I am harder than I believed, or weaker. There are two methods of taking a look at it. It does show that I am human. It is not about what number of caps you’ve, what number of stripes you’ve, or how well-known you might be.
‘Your physique does not say, “You are a former England captain, we’re not going to permit this sickness to invade you”.
‘There have been a great deal of occasions once I would not exit, as a result of I used to be embarrassed. Even climbing out and in of a automobile was terrible.’
